The Allied Mistress 39 is described as being "aimed at the cruising yachtsman who wants more comfort, privacy, and docility than the currently popular fin keel/spade rudder racing machine offers".
The Mistress was the largest of the original fleet Allied built. This is a rare aft cockpit model, we believe her to be the last built.
Bojangles has traveled the world under the previous owner and is currently undergoing a refit to be able to do it again.
Her long keel, shallow draft and 700 sq. ft. ketch rig make her an easily driven, easily handled vessel with good potential for island cruising. Sail area can be reduced quickly and drastically by dropping the main and running under the working jib and mizzen thus reducing crew requirements.
Mast height is a bridge-friendly 56', making her very stable and stiff.
Furling Genoa and staysail make for lots of options in both light and heavy wind.
